About Andrew Lui

Andrew Lui is a scholar working on Mechanical Engineering, Aerospace Engineering, Materials Chemistry, Automotive Engineering and Electrical and Electronic Engineering, having authored 29 papers that have together received 812 indexed citations. Recurring topics across this work include Aluminum Alloy Microstructure Properties (15 papers), Solidification and crystal growth phenomena (10 papers), Metallurgical Processes and Thermodynamics (6 papers), Additive Manufacturing Materials and Processes (4 papers), Aluminum Alloys Composites Properties (4 papers), Metal Alloys Wear and Properties (3 papers), Microstructure and mechanical properties (3 papers) and Advanced materials and composites (3 papers). The work is most often cited by research in Aerospace Engineering (473 citations), Mechanical Engineering (472 citations), Automotive Engineering (127 citations), Materials Chemistry (417 citations) and Biomedical Engineering (138 citations). Andrew Lui has collaborated with scholars based in United Kingdom, Norway and China. Frequent co-authors include Patrick S. Grant, Enzo Liotti, Thomas Connolley, S. Kumar, Zhengxiao Guo, Ragnvald H. Mathiesen, C.E.J. Dancer, Susannah Speller, Y. Wang and Flynn Castles. Their work appears in journals such as Acta Materialia, Materials & Design, Scripta Materialia, Canadian Metallurgical Quarterly and Scientific Reports.
